Canadian Pecan Cookies Recipe

Ingredients:  
Ingredients:  
1 cup butter, softened
1/2 cup brown sugar, firmly packed
2 tbsp. sugar
1 egg
1 tsp. vanilla extract
2 cups flour
2/3 cup pecans, finely chopped

Directions:
Directions:
In a large mixing bowl, cream the butter and brown sugar. Add sugar, egg and vanilla; mix well. Add in the flour and pecans by hand. Roll into 1-inch balls. Put balls on parchment-lined cookie sheets and press down with a fork to make a criss-cross, like you would a peanut butter cookie. Bake in a preheated 350º oven for 12 minutes or until light brown.

Personal Notes:
Personal Notes:
This recipe was from our great grandmother. During the war she stopped making these cookies because the ingredients were too expensive. Our mom found the recipe many years later and made them every holiday. They were always one of our family's favorite cookies!
